摘要
目的 探讨丙烯腈对雄性小鼠生殖细胞的毒性作用。方法 将 40只昆明种雄性小鼠随机分成 5组 ,阴性对照组 (生理盐水 0 1ml/ 10g)、低剂量组 (丙烯腈 2mg/kg)、中剂量组 (丙烯腈 4mg/kg)、高剂量组 (丙烯腈 8mg/kg)和阳性对照组 (环磷酰胺 2 0mg/kg)。每天皮下注射 1次 ,连续 5天。实验结束处死动物 ,取材 ,做初级精母细胞染色体畸变分析及精子畸形试验。结果 皮下注射丙烯腈 2mg/kg ,4mg/kg和 8mg/kg组小鼠睾丸初级精母细胞染色体畸变率、细胞畸变率及精子畸形率均显著高于阴性对照组。结论 丙烯腈对雄性小鼠的生殖细胞有致突变效应 ,并对精子的生成有毒害作用。
Objective To study the effects of acrylonitrile(AN)on germ cells in male mice.Methods Forty male mice of Kunming strain were divided randomly into five groups,i.e.,negative control group treated with normal saline 0 1ml/10g of body weight,low dose group with 2 mg/kg of AN,medium dose group with 4mg/kg of AN,high dose group with 8 mg/kg of AN and positive control group with 20 mg/kg of cytoxan by subcutaneous injection once daily for five days.Then,the animals were killed and their bio specimens were collected and the chromosome aberration of primary spermatocyte and sperm deformity test were performed for them.Results The rates of chromosome aberration of primary spermatocyte,cell deformity and sperm deformity were significantly higher in the animals treated with 2 mg/kg,4 mg/kg and 8 mg/kg of AN by subcutaneous injection than those with negative controls.Conclusions Acrylonitrile could have mutagenic effects in male mice,which was hazardous and toxic to their spermatogenesis.
